diff options
author | rodent <rodent> | 2014-05-16 01:34:43 +0000 |
---|---|---|
committer | rodent <rodent> | 2014-05-16 01:34:43 +0000 |
commit | e021b8b5f6a715310c9b78ae613955c13aa40e4a (patch) | |
tree | 7ac2815715b900466ceea7362e24216732543644 /textproc/py-tinycss | |
parent | 95b9c32999409563f09dceb44ea74a3759d3931e (diff) | |
download | pkgsrc-e021b8b5f6a715310c9b78ae613955c13aa40e4a.tar.gz |
Import py27-tinycss-0.3 as textproc/py-tinycss.
tinycss is a complete yet simple CSS parser for Python. It supports the full
syntax and error handling for CSS 2.1 as well as some CSS 3 modules:
* CSS Color 3;
* CSS Paged Media 3;
It is designed to be easy to extend for new CSS modules and syntax, and
integrates well with cssselect for Selectors 3 support.
Diffstat (limited to 'textproc/py-tinycss')
-rw-r--r-- | textproc/py-tinycss/DESCR | 8 | ||||
-rw-r--r-- | textproc/py-tinycss/Makefile | 14 | ||||
-rw-r--r-- | textproc/py-tinycss/PLIST | 57 | ||||
-rw-r--r-- | textproc/py-tinycss/distinfo | 5 |
4 files changed, 84 insertions, 0 deletions
diff --git a/textproc/py-tinycss/DESCR b/textproc/py-tinycss/DESCR new file mode 100644 index 00000000000..c3dad6ed109 --- /dev/null +++ b/textproc/py-tinycss/DESCR @@ -0,0 +1,8 @@ +tinycss is a complete yet simple CSS parser for Python. It supports the full +syntax and error handling for CSS 2.1 as well as some CSS 3 modules: + + * CSS Color 3; + * CSS Paged Media 3; + +It is designed to be easy to extend for new CSS modules and syntax, and +integrates well with cssselect for Selectors 3 support. diff --git a/textproc/py-tinycss/Makefile b/textproc/py-tinycss/Makefile new file mode 100644 index 00000000000..8eff36ab989 --- /dev/null +++ b/textproc/py-tinycss/Makefile @@ -0,0 +1,14 @@ +# $NetBSD: Makefile,v 1.1 2014/05/16 01:34:43 rodent Exp $ + +DISTNAME= tinycss-0.3 +PKGNAME= ${PYPKGPREFIX}-${DISTNAME} +CATEGORIES= python textproc +MASTER_SITES= https://pypi.python.org/packages/source/t/tinycss/ + +MAINTAINER= rodent@NetBSD.org +HOMEPAGE= http://packages.python.org/tinycss/ +COMMENT= Complete yet simple CSS parser for Python +LICENSE= modified-bsd + +.include "../../lang/python/egg.mk" +.include "../../mk/bsd.pkg.mk" diff --git a/textproc/py-tinycss/PLIST b/textproc/py-tinycss/PLIST new file mode 100644 index 00000000000..c4a3233235b --- /dev/null +++ b/textproc/py-tinycss/PLIST @@ -0,0 +1,57 @@ +@comment $NetBSD: PLIST,v 1.1 2014/05/16 01:34:43 rodent Exp $ +${PYSITELIB}/${EGG_INFODIR}/PKG-INFO +${PYSITELIB}/${EGG_INFODIR}/SOURCES.txt +${PYSITELIB}/${EGG_INFODIR}/dependency_links.txt +${PYSITELIB}/${EGG_INFODIR}/top_level.txt +${PYSITELIB}/tinycss/__init__.py +${PYSITELIB}/tinycss/__init__.pyc +${PYSITELIB}/tinycss/__init__.pyo +${PYSITELIB}/tinycss/color3.py +${PYSITELIB}/tinycss/color3.pyc +${PYSITELIB}/tinycss/color3.pyo +${PYSITELIB}/tinycss/css21.py +${PYSITELIB}/tinycss/css21.pyc +${PYSITELIB}/tinycss/css21.pyo +${PYSITELIB}/tinycss/decoding.py +${PYSITELIB}/tinycss/decoding.pyc +${PYSITELIB}/tinycss/decoding.pyo +${PYSITELIB}/tinycss/page3.py +${PYSITELIB}/tinycss/page3.pyc +${PYSITELIB}/tinycss/page3.pyo +${PYSITELIB}/tinycss/parsing.py +${PYSITELIB}/tinycss/parsing.pyc +${PYSITELIB}/tinycss/parsing.pyo +${PYSITELIB}/tinycss/speedups.so +${PYSITELIB}/tinycss/tests/__init__.py +${PYSITELIB}/tinycss/tests/__init__.pyc +${PYSITELIB}/tinycss/tests/__init__.pyo +${PYSITELIB}/tinycss/tests/speed.py +${PYSITELIB}/tinycss/tests/speed.pyc +${PYSITELIB}/tinycss/tests/speed.pyo +${PYSITELIB}/tinycss/tests/test_api.py +${PYSITELIB}/tinycss/tests/test_api.pyc +${PYSITELIB}/tinycss/tests/test_api.pyo +${PYSITELIB}/tinycss/tests/test_color3.py +${PYSITELIB}/tinycss/tests/test_color3.pyc +${PYSITELIB}/tinycss/tests/test_color3.pyo +${PYSITELIB}/tinycss/tests/test_css21.py +${PYSITELIB}/tinycss/tests/test_css21.pyc +${PYSITELIB}/tinycss/tests/test_css21.pyo +${PYSITELIB}/tinycss/tests/test_decoding.py +${PYSITELIB}/tinycss/tests/test_decoding.pyc +${PYSITELIB}/tinycss/tests/test_decoding.pyo +${PYSITELIB}/tinycss/tests/test_page3.py +${PYSITELIB}/tinycss/tests/test_page3.pyc +${PYSITELIB}/tinycss/tests/test_page3.pyo +${PYSITELIB}/tinycss/tests/test_tokenizer.py +${PYSITELIB}/tinycss/tests/test_tokenizer.pyc +${PYSITELIB}/tinycss/tests/test_tokenizer.pyo +${PYSITELIB}/tinycss/token_data.py +${PYSITELIB}/tinycss/token_data.pyc +${PYSITELIB}/tinycss/token_data.pyo +${PYSITELIB}/tinycss/tokenizer.py +${PYSITELIB}/tinycss/tokenizer.pyc +${PYSITELIB}/tinycss/tokenizer.pyo +${PYSITELIB}/tinycss/version.py +${PYSITELIB}/tinycss/version.pyc +${PYSITELIB}/tinycss/version.pyo diff --git a/textproc/py-tinycss/distinfo b/textproc/py-tinycss/distinfo new file mode 100644 index 00000000000..09c768bfebc --- /dev/null +++ b/textproc/py-tinycss/distinfo @@ -0,0 +1,5 @@ +$NetBSD: distinfo,v 1.1 2014/05/16 01:34:43 rodent Exp $ + +SHA1 (tinycss-0.3.tar.gz) = b6dc84ada625569cbbe5526ff2667c10b99c4cc9 +RMD160 (tinycss-0.3.tar.gz) = 7bf63f83ffd0ebc7690c84180c17ecebc173fdf0 +Size (tinycss-0.3.tar.gz) = 72860 bytes |